Last year, the so-called Binance Coin increased by nearly 1,300%. Zhao’s worth might be even bigger, as the estimate excludes his personal crypto assets, which include Bitcoin and his company’s own token. It’s the first time Bloomberg has calculated Zhao’s net worth, which surpasses Mukesh Ambani, Asia’s richest man, and rivals tech titans like Mark Zuckerberg and Google founders Larry Page and Sergey Brin.
